Inventory Coordinator
1 day ago
We are seeking a highly organized and detail-oriented individual to support our Church Ministry team in resourcing events and field staff with equipment and materials. The successful candidate will ensure timely shipments, track assets, and maintain accurate records.
Key Responsibilities- Assist Church Ministry staff in identifying materials for upcoming events and communicating with event staff, Distribution Services, and field contacts to ensure events are properly resourced.
- Locate and confirm warehouse facilities for tour materials, ensuring timely and cost-effective solutions.
- Load, offload, and inventory tour materials, ensuring quality control and accuracy.
- Work closely with Distribution Services to ensure accurate and timely shipments to venues.
- Provide prompt responses to questions and issues related to materials and shipment delivery.
- Evaluate returned materials and update inventory as necessary.
- Collaborate with Distribution Services to initiate sales orders and process internal requests.
- College degree or equivalent and related experience preferred.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office suite software.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with a focus on problem-solving.
- Ability to work independently, prioritizing tasks and managing multiple projects in a fast-paced environment.
- Attention to detail, initiative, and follow-through.
- Capacity to build and cultivate cross-departmental relationships.
- Conventional office environment.
- Required to travel to tour locations for the duration of the tour schedule, estimated 2-3 weeks of continuous travel one or two times per year.
